Transaction 4123634d0bfefe281012874e4252f68b90c25bad8699b2afbc68e78c7e6086de
1 Input
1 Output
-
4123634d0bfefe281012874e4252f68b90c25bad8699b2afbc68e78c7e6086de:0
- value
- 16544508
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 977bc3f228b6e9b0d863f47d8c84f59e72b79812 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1EoyJLcNfxmYmEK7NBRgUUMansmkJPHDm9